Located in El Paso, TX, Los Portales is a wedding venue brimming with historical appeal. Couples can easily celebrate in a magical and memorable way in this charming setting. The venue was originally built in 1932 and is an adobe-style structure. It sits on the old route to Mesilla, which is also called the Don Juan de Oñate route. In the 1940s and 1950s, it served as a women's club where people could gather for a range of events before it became a church. Lovingly refurbished after being abandoned for many years, this locale can easily be transformed to fit a range of wedding themes.
There are both indoor and outdoor options for wedding ceremonies and receptions at Los Portales. The venue has a rustic ambience, with wood architectural details and simple white walls. This understated design suits a range of color palettes. The wedding packages are designed for celebrations with up to 50 people. Other events can be hosted here, such as quinceañeras, family gatherings, corporate events, and more.
The team at Los Portales aims to be flexible and they work with nearly weds to help them organize their dream event. They offer all-inclusive packages to make planning your special day straightforward but are also open to outside vendors. The venue's services include catering and beverages, linens, and event management. The team also offers security and can serve the cuisine, ensuring high standards of customer care are met. In addition, the packages include tables, chairs, linens, outdoor cocktail tables, and more.
